Humanism: The Architecture of Human-Centered Thought

The Historical Emergence of Humanist Thought

Humanism emerged during the Renaissance as a revolutionary intellectual movement that shifted the center of philosophical gravity from divine authority to human experience. This transformation represented not merely a change in philosophical emphasis but a fundamental reorientation of how humans understood their relationship to knowledge, to ethical systems, and to existence itself. Renaissance thinkers like Pico della Mirandola, who in his “Oration on the Dignity of Man” (1486) proclaimed humanity’s unique capacity for self-determination, established the conceptual foundation for a worldview that placed human agency at its center.

This intellectual revolution drew inspiration from classical Greco-Roman traditions, which privileged rational inquiry and celebrated human achievement. By reviving and reinterpreting these ancient philosophies, Renaissance humanists created a new intellectual framework that embraced the study of humanities (studia humanitatis), advocated for critical engagement with texts, and elevated the pursuit of knowledge as a defining human activity. As humanist scholar Petrarch wrote, “It is better to will the good than to know the truth”—signaling a shift toward active engagement with the world rather than passive contemplation of divine mysteries.

The trajectory of humanist thought continued through the Enlightenment, where thinkers like Kant emphasized the importance of reason as both the foundation of knowledge and the basis for moral judgment. Kant’s famous imperative to “dare to know” (sapere aude) encapsulated the humanist commitment to intellectual autonomy and critical thinking. This philosophical position would eventually evolve into secular humanism, which maintained the centrality of human experience while explicitly rejecting religious frameworks as the necessary foundation for ethical systems.

The Philosophical Architecture of Humanism

The humanist intellectual edifice rests upon several foundational pillars that together constitute a coherent philosophical worldview:

Reason as the Arbiter of Truth

Humanist philosophy elevates rational inquiry as the primary method for discerning truth. By privileging empirical observation, logical analysis, and skeptical investigation, humanism constructs an epistemological framework that values evidence over authority and reasoned argument over revelation. This commitment to rationalism undergirds the scientific method, which has transformed our understanding of the natural world and our capacity to manipulate it.

In his seminal work “An Essay Concerning Human Understanding” (1689), John Locke articulated this empiricist orientation: “No man’s knowledge here can go beyond his experience.” This epistemological stance positions human cognitive capacities as the ultimate arbiters of knowledge claims, firmly locating epistemological authority within human faculties rather than external sources.

The Inherent Dignity of the Human Person

Perhaps the most enduring contribution of humanist thought is its insistence on the inherent dignity and worth of every human being. This principle transcends cultural, religious, and historical boundaries, asserting that dignity is not contingent upon social status, belief systems, or external validation but is intrinsic to human existence itself. This concept provided the philosophical foundation for modern human rights discourse, which maintains that certain rights are inalienable precisely because they are grounded in human dignity.

The Universal Declaration of Human Rights (1948) begins with the recognition of “the inherent dignity and of the equal and inalienable rights of all members of the human family,” explicitly acknowledging its intellectual debt to humanist principles. This focus on dignity has profound implications for ethics, politics, and social organization, establishing a standard against which social arrangements can be evaluated.

Empathic Understanding as Ethical Foundation

Humanism embraces empathy as a crucial component of ethical life. By recognizing the experiential reality of others and acknowledging their capacity for suffering and flourishing, humanist ethics establishes a framework for moral consideration that extends beyond self-interest. This empathic orientation fosters a sense of solidarity and mutual responsibility, creating the grounds for cooperative social arrangements.

Philosopher Martha Nussbaum argues that this capacity for empathic imagination is essential for constructing just societies: “The ability to imagine the situation of others… is an essential moral capacity without which we would be morally blind.” This perspective underscores the humanist commitment to understanding the lived experiences of others as a prerequisite for ethical action.

Progressive Optimism and Human Potential

Humanism maintains a fundamentally optimistic view of human potential, asserting that through education, scientific advancement, and social reform, humanity can progressively improve its condition. This progressive orientation stands in contrast to theological perspectives that emphasize human fallenness or philosophical traditions that regard human nature as fixed and immutable.

Humanist philosopher John Dewey articulated this progressive vision when he wrote, “Such happiness as life is capable of comes from the full participation of all our powers in the endeavor to wrest from each changing situation of experience its own full and unique meaning.” This perspective frames human flourishing as an ongoing project of creative engagement with the world, a process of continuous growth and development.

The Social Impact of Humanist Thought

The influence of humanist philosophy extends far beyond academic discourse, fundamentally shaping modern social and political institutions. The Enlightenment ideals of liberty, equality, and fraternity—deeply informed by humanist principles—provided the intellectual foundation for democratic revolutions in America and France, establishing new forms of governance predicated on human rights rather than divine right.

The abolitionist movement drew heavily on humanist arguments about the fundamental equality of all persons, challenging the dehumanization inherent in slavery. Frederick Douglass, in his famous 1852 speech “What to the Slave is the Fourth of July?”, invoked humanist principles when he declared, “The rich inheritance of justice, liberty, prosperity and independence, bequeathed by your fathers, is shared by you, not by me.” By highlighting this contradiction, Douglass employed humanist reasoning to expose the moral inconsistency of a nation founded on equality while practicing slavery.

Similarly, the women’s suffrage movement, civil rights movements, and LGBTQ+ equality movements all advanced their causes by appealing to humanist principles of dignity, equality, and justice. By consistently expanding the circle of moral consideration to include previously marginalized groups, these movements demonstrated the progressive potential inherent in humanist ethics.

Contemporary global initiatives addressing poverty, inequality, climate change, and public health likewise draw upon humanist values that emphasize collective responsibility and human flourishing. Organizations like the United Nations, with its commitment to “promoting and encouraging respect for human rights and for fundamental freedoms for all,” exemplify the institutional embodiment of humanist principles on a global scale.

Transhumanism: Transcending Biological Limitations

The Conceptual Foundations of Transhumanist Thought

Transhumanism represents a philosophical and cultural movement that seeks to transcend current human limitations through technological means. Unlike traditional humanism, which primarily emphasizes human dignity and potential within existing biological parameters, transhumanism explicitly advocates for the deliberate transformation of the human condition through advanced technologies. This transformative aspiration encompasses biological enhancement, cognitive augmentation, and potentially radical life extension.

The term “transhumanism” was popularized by Julian Huxley, who in his 1957 essay “Transhumanism” described it as “man remaining man, but transcending himself, by realizing new possibilities of and for his human nature.” This vision fundamentally extends the humanist project of human improvement beyond cultural and educational means to include direct biological and cognitive enhancement through technological intervention.

Transhumanist philosophy stands at the intersection of Enlightenment rationalism, scientific optimism, and technological progressivism. It maintains humanism’s commitment to reason and empiricism but radically expands the scope of human self-determination to include the deliberate redesign of human biology itself. As philosopher and transhumanist advocate Nick Bostrom suggests, “Transhumanism is a loosely defined movement that has developed gradually over the past two decades… [It] promotes an interdisciplinary approach to understanding and evaluating the opportunities for enhancing the human condition and the human organism opened up by the advancement of technology.”

Historical Development and Key Influences

The intellectual genealogy of transhumanism draws from diverse sources, including Renaissance humanism, Enlightenment philosophy, evolutionary theory, and futurism. Francis Bacon’s “New Atlantis” (1627), which envisioned a society transformed by scientific knowledge, prefigured transhumanist themes of technological transformation. Similarly, Condorcet’s “Sketch for a Historical Picture of the Progress of the Human Spirit” (1795) anticipated the transhumanist vision of continual human improvement through rational means.

In the early 20th century, J.B.S. Haldane’s essay “Daedalus; or, Science and the Future” (1923) and J.D. Bernal’s “The World, the Flesh and the Devil” (1929) explored the possibilities of genetic engineering and cybernetic enhancement, establishing conceptual foundations for later transhumanist thought. These early works speculated about how emerging technologies might fundamentally alter human capabilities and extend lifespans.

Contemporary transhumanist discourse emerged more formally in the 1980s and 1990s, with figures like Max More, Natasha Vita-More, and Hans Moravec articulating comprehensive transhumanist philosophies. Max More’s “Principles of Extropy” (1990) outlined key transhumanist values including perpetual progress, self-transformation, and technological optimism. These principles were further developed and refined in the “Transhumanist Declaration” (1998, revised 2009), which established a framework for responsible advocacy of human enhancement technologies.

The acceleration of technological progress, particularly in fields like artificial intelligence, biotechnology, and nanotechnology, has lent increasing plausibility to transhumanist aspirations. Ray Kurzweil’s concept of the “technological singularity”—a hypothetical point where technological growth becomes uncontrollable and irreversible, resulting in unforeseeable changes to human civilization—has become a central reference point in transhumanist discourse, representing both the promise and potential peril of accelerating technological development.

The Transhumanist Vision of Enhanced Humanity

Transhumanism articulates a comprehensive vision of human enhancement that encompasses multiple dimensions of the human experience. This vision includes several key elements:

Biological Enhancement and Morphological Freedom

Transhumanists advocate for the use of biotechnology, genetic engineering, and nanotechnology to augment human physical capabilities and overcome biological limitations. This includes not only therapeutic interventions to address disease and disability but also enhancement technologies that might extend human capabilities beyond their natural parameters. The principle of “morphological freedom”—the right to modify one’s own body according to one’s desires—represents a central ethical commitment within transhumanist thought.

Philosopher Anders Sandberg describes this aspiration: “Morphological freedom is about the right to modify oneself according to one’s desires… This right includes the right to use technology to extend one’s abilities beyond the ‘natural’ and species-typical boundaries, as well as the right to refuse modifications.” This principle extends individual autonomy to include decisions about one’s biological constitution, challenging traditional distinctions between therapy and enhancement.

Cognitive Enhancement and Intelligence Amplification

Transhumanists place particular emphasis on technologies that might enhance human cognitive capabilities, including pharmacological interventions (nootropics), brain-computer interfaces, neural implants, and potentially the development of artificial general intelligence that could complement or extend human mental capacities. The goal is not merely to address cognitive impairments but to systematically improve memory, attention, reasoning, and creativity beyond current human limitations.

Computer scientist and transhumanist theorist Vernor Vinge articulated this vision in his influential paper “The Coming Technological Singularity” (1993): “Within thirty years, we will have the technological means to create superhuman intelligence. Shortly after, the human era will be ended.” While this prediction might seem extreme, it reflects the transhumanist commitment to radical cognitive enhancement as a pathway to unprecedented intellectual achievement.

Radical Life Extension and Immortalism

Perhaps the most ambitious aspect of the transhumanist project is its commitment to radical life extension, sometimes extending to theoretical immortality. Drawing on research in regenerative medicine, molecular repair mechanisms, and potential technologies like mind uploading, transhumanists challenge the assumption that biological aging and death are inevitable. Instead, they frame mortality as a technical problem potentially amenable to scientific solutions.

Aubrey de Grey, a biomedical gerontologist and transhumanist advocate, argues that aging should be conceptualized as a disease that can be treated: “The idea that aging is not a disease and therefore should not be treated is exactly as absurd as saying that multiple sclerosis is not a disease either, because everyone has a degeneration of their myelin sheaths as they get older… It’s just a matter of degree.” This reframing of aging as a medical condition rather than an inevitable biological process exemplifies the transhumanist approach to longevity.

Digital Consciousness and Mind Uploading

Some transhumanist thinkers explore the possibility of transferring human consciousness to digital substrates—a process often referred to as “mind uploading” or “whole brain emulation.” This speculative technology would involve scanning the structural details of a human brain and recreating those details in a computational system with sufficient fidelity to preserve the original person’s memories, personality, and consciousness. If realized, such technology could potentially enable forms of existence unconstrained by biological limitations.

Posthumanism: Decentering the Human

Conceptual Foundations and Historical Context

Posthumanism represents a philosophical movement that fundamentally challenges anthropocentrism—the positioning of humans as the central or most significant species. Unlike transhumanism, which seeks to enhance and extend human capabilities through technology while maintaining human identity as its reference point, posthumanism questions the very category of “human” and its privileged position in ethical and ontological frameworks.

The intellectual roots of posthumanism can be traced to poststructuralist critiques of humanism, feminist theory, postcolonial studies, and environmental philosophy. Thinkers like Michel Foucault, who famously declared that “man is an invention of recent date… and one perhaps nearing its end,” provided conceptual tools for questioning the stability and coherence of the human subject. Similarly, Donna Haraway’s influential essay “A Cyborg Manifesto” (1985) challenged traditional boundaries between humans, animals, and machines, envisioning hybrid identities that transcend conventional categories.

Posthumanist philosophy emerged more formally in the 1990s, with scholars like N. Katherine Hayles, Cary Wolfe, and Rosi Braidotti developing comprehensive posthumanist frameworks. Hayles, in her groundbreaking work “How We Became Posthuman” (1999), examined how information technologies have transformed human subjectivity, arguing that “the posthuman view privileges informational pattern over material instantiation.” This perspective challenges the assumption that consciousness must be embodied in a particular biological form, opening possibilities for reconceptualizing what constitutes a person.

Posthumanist Critiques of Humanism and Transhumanism

Posthumanism offers penetrating critiques of both humanist and transhumanist assumptions:

Critique of Anthropocentrism

Posthumanism challenges the humanist tendency to position humans as exceptional beings with unique moral status. Instead, it advocates for a more inclusive ethical framework that recognizes the moral significance of non-human entities, including animals, ecosystems, and potentially artificial intelligences. This ecological sensibility emphasizes interconnectedness and interdependence rather than human exceptionalism.

Environmental philosopher Arne Naess articulated this perspective in his deep ecology framework: “The flourishing of human and non-human life on Earth has intrinsic value… Humans have no right to reduce this richness and diversity except to satisfy vital needs.” This position directly challenges anthropocentric ethics, which privileges human interests above all others.

Critique of Dualistic Thinking

Posthumanism rejects Cartesian dualism—the separation of mind from body, culture from nature, human from animal—arguing that such binary oppositions distort our understanding of reality and reinforce problematic power hierarchies. Instead, posthumanism emphasizes continuity, hybridity, and entanglement as more accurate descriptions of existence.

Feminist philosopher Karen Barad describes this perspective as “agential realism,” arguing that “the world is an ongoing intra-active engagement, and bodies, including human bodies, are but some of the intra-active engagements.” This ontological framework dissolves rigid boundaries between subject and object, positioning all entities as mutually constituted through their interactions.

Critique of Technological Instrumentalism

While transhumanism tends to view technology as a tool for human enhancement, posthumanism suggests that technology fundamentally alters what it means to be human and cannot be understood as a neutral instrument. Instead, technological systems co-evolve with human societies, generating new forms of subjectivity and social organization that cannot be reduced to human intentions or control.

Philosopher Bernard Stiegler captures this perspective when he argues that “the human is technologically constituted.” This view suggests that technology is not merely something humans use but is rather constitutive of human identity itself—a position that challenges both the humanist conception of autonomous human subjects and the transhumanist vision of technological enhancement as an extension of human agency.

Posthumanist Conceptions of Identity and Embodiment

Posthumanism proposes radical revisions to traditional understandings of identity and embodiment:

Distributed Cognition and Extended Mind

Posthumanist thinkers challenge the notion that cognition is contained within individual brains, arguing instead that cognitive processes are distributed across bodies, technologies, and environments. This “extended mind” thesis, developed by philosophers Andy Clark and David Chalmers, suggests that external objects can function as part of an integrated cognitive system, fundamentally blurring the boundaries between self and world.

As Clark argues, “We create extended cognitive systems by coupling with external resources in ways that yield distributed cognitive systems whose computational and problem-solving abilities are different from and enhanced relative to those of the naked brain.” This perspective challenges the assumption that identity is bounded by the skin, suggesting instead that we are fundamentally extended beings whose mental processes span multiple substrates.

Hybrid Identities and Cyborg Subjectivity

Posthumanism embraces hybrid identities that transcend traditional categories, recognizing that humans have always been entangled with technologies, other species, and environments. Donna Haraway’s concept of the cyborg—”a hybrid of machine and organism”—serves as a powerful metaphor for this understanding of identity as inherently hybrid and relational.

Critical Analysis: Philosophical and Ethical Dilemmas

Transhumanism: Promises and Perils

Transhumanism presents both compelling promises and profound perils that merit careful ethical consideration:

The Problem of Inequality and Access

Perhaps the most immediate ethical concern regarding enhancement technologies is the potential to exacerbate existing social inequalities. If enhancement technologies develop within market systems that distribute access according to ability to pay, they risk creating unprecedented forms of stratification—potentially dividing humanity into enhanced and unenhanced populations.

Political philosopher Michael Sandel articulates this concern: “The problem with genetic enhancement lies in the hubris of the designing parents, in their drive to master the mystery of birth… And in the way enhancement, if it becomes widespread, might transform the character of social institutions.” This perspective highlights how enhancement technologies might not only reflect existing inequalities but fundamentally transform social relations in ways that undermine democratic values.

The Question of Human Nature and Identity

Transhumanist ambitions raise profound questions about human nature and identity. If humans can be radically transformed through technological intervention, what remains of human identity? Is there an essential human nature that should be preserved, or is humanity defined by its capacity for self-transformation?

Philosopher Francis Fukuyama argues that enhancement technologies threaten “Factor X”—the essential quality that provides the basis for human dignity and rights: “We want to protect the full range of our complex, evolved natures against attempts at self-modification that would alter us into something less than human.” This perspective suggests that certain transformations might compromise fundamental aspects of human identity that are worth preserving.

Existential Risks and Unforeseen Consequences

The accelerating development of powerful technologies—particularly artificial intelligence, biotechnology, and nanotechnology—introduces existential risks that could potentially threaten human survival. These risks include unintended consequences, malicious applications, loss of control over autonomous systems, and irreversible changes to human biology or psychology.

Oxford philosopher Nick Bostrom, despite his transhumanist orientation, acknowledges these risks: “We need to be very careful about how we create artificial intelligence, because how we take the first steps will determine where we end up.” This caution reflects an awareness that technological development can generate unforeseen consequences that may be difficult or impossible to reverse once set in motion.

Psychological and Spiritual Dimensions

Beyond physical and cognitive enhancement, transhumanist aspirations raise profound psychological and spiritual questions about the meaning of life, the value of limitation, and the nature of fulfillment. If mortality and vulnerability are constitutive aspects of human experience, how might their elimination transform the human condition?

Philosopher Martha Nussbaum argues that vulnerability is integral to human flourishing: “To be a good human being is to have a kind of openness to the world, an ability to trust uncertain things beyond your own control.” This perspective suggests that certain forms of enhancement might compromise aspects of human experience that, while involving vulnerability, are nonetheless essential to a meaningful life.

The prospect of extreme longevity or theoretical immortality raises particularly profound questions about meaning and purpose. As philosopher Bernard Williams argues in his essay “The Makropulos Case,” immortality might lead to profound boredom or detachment—a condition in which nothing has genuine significance because everything can be indefinitely deferred. This perspective challenges the assumption that longer life necessarily translates to greater fulfillment.
